Cropping Images zzTwo cropping guide lines are displayed when you access the crop frame (=20) when [Standard] or [Dual] size is selected in [ID Photo]. zzWhen [Standard] is selected, to print a photo that conforms to passport standards for face size and position, adjust the crop frame so that one line is above the head and the other is below the chin. zzWhen [Dual] is selected, two frames with differing sizes are displayed simultaneously. • For specific requirements other than face size and position, contact the institution that requires the photo. Selecting and Printing Images from History (Reprint) Images printed from Select & Print (=14) remain in the history. Images can be selected from the print history and printed. 1 Access the print history. zzPress the button. zzPress the buttons to select [Reprint], and then press the button.
